Acne

Acne is the term for plugged pores (blackheads and whiteheads), pimples, and even deeper lumps (cysts or nodules) that occur on the face, neck, chest, back, shoulders and even the upper arms. Acne affects most teenagers to some degree. However, the disease is not restricted to a particular age group; adults in their 20s - even into their 40s - can get acne. While not a life threatening condition, acne can be upsetting and disfiguring. Severe acne can lead to serious and permanent scarring. Although tempting, do not "pop" or squeeze blemishes. This can lead to permanent scarring. Additionally, vigorous washing and scrubbing can irritate your skin and make acne worse. Premier Dermatologists recommend gently washing the affected areas twice a day with mild cleanser and warm water.
